Paul Bowman 1850–1936 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 17 Jun 1850

Birth Location: Williamsburg Dundas Co, Ontario, Canada

Death Date: 19 Aug 1936

Death Location: Morrisburg, Stormont, Dundas and Glengarry United Counties, Ontario, Canada

Father: Thomas Bowman

Mother: Mary Glenton

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

In 1850, Paul Bowman entered the world in Williamsburg Dundas Co, Ontario, Canada, born to Thomas Bowman And Mary Glenton. Paul Bowman passed away in 1936 in Morrisburg, Stormont, Dundas and Glengarry United Counties, Ontario, Canada.
